As nouns the difference between hornblende and biotite

is that hornblende is a green to black amphibole mineral, of complex structure, formed in the late stages of cooling in igneous rock while biotite is a dark brown mica; it is a mixed aluminosilicate and fluoride of potassium, magnesium and iron.
